New Info to my Intel NUC - sound - Problem:
I tried all the things Milehouse mentioned above with no success (recreating the guisettings.xml, etc).
But suprise: with the x86 - build #0217 the problem is gone. The gui-sounds are working now.
So it seems to be a generic NUC - problem.
Knock on wood ...
19.02.2017: Update: With the new build the sound was gone again, BUT...
I cycled under Audio through the output optimation - values and with the setting 'Fixed' the gui sound works.
With any of the other: No gui-sound.
This setting didn't affect the sound while watching a movie.
